拥有完善的设计流程与质量管控体系,从需求沟通到初稿交付、修改优化全程透明,72 小时快速响应需求,保障项目高效推进。 SVG动图在响应式设计中的应用,企业官网SVG动图设计,SVG动图,电商网站SVG动图交互开发18140119082
创意设计公司 高端定制·原创设计
发布时间 2026-04-09 SVG动图

  在现代网页设计中,SVG动图因其轻量级、高清晰度和良好的可交互性,已成为提升用户体验的重要工具。相比传统图片格式,如PNG或JPEG,SVG动图不仅文件体积更小,还能在任意缩放下保持边缘锐利,特别适合响应式布局和移动端场景。随着用户对视觉体验要求的不断提高,越来越多的网站开始采用SVG动图来实现加载动画、图标悬停反馈、数据可视化图表等动态效果。然而,尽管技术门槛相对较低,实际创作过程中仍存在诸多挑战:代码冗余、动画卡顿、浏览器兼容性差异等问题时常困扰开发者。尤其在复杂动效设计中,若缺乏系统化方法,很容易导致性能下降,反而影响页面加载速度。

  理解SVG动图的核心优势与适用场景

  要高效创作SVG动图,首先需要明确其核心优势——基于矢量图形的动态表现形式。由于SVG本质上是XML语言描述的图形结构,因此可以被浏览器直接解析并渲染,支持通过CSS或JavaScript进行动画控制。这种特性使得它非常适合用于创建可交互的图标、进度条、菜单切换动画以及微交互动画。例如,在电商网站首页使用一个循环播放的购物车图标动画,既能吸引注意力又不会拖慢页面;在金融类应用中,用SVG动图展示柱状图随时间变化的数据趋势,既直观又节省资源。这些应用场景都体现了SVG动图在“轻量化”与“高表现力”之间的完美平衡。

  SVG动图

  从零开始构建高效的创作流程

  针对常见的制作效率低、代码重复等问题,建议采用模块化设计思路。将常用动画组件(如按钮点击反馈、加载旋转、展开收起)抽象为独立的SVG片段,再通过符号引用()和标签复用,极大减少冗余代码。同时,结合GSAP(GreenSock Animation Platform)或Lottie这类成熟工具,能够轻松实现复杂路径动画、逐帧动画和时间轴控制。例如,利用GSAP的pathData插件,可以让一个图标沿着预设路径滑动,而无需手动编写复杂的贝塞尔曲线计算逻辑。此外,对于需要频繁更新的动效,推荐使用JSON配置驱动动画参数,便于后期维护与团队协作。

  优化与性能监控不可忽视

  即便拥有精巧的设计,若忽视性能优化,最终效果也可能适得其反。建议在输出前使用SVGO(SVG Optimizer)对SVG文件进行压缩处理,移除注释、多余属性、未使用的命名空间等无用内容,通常可缩减30%以上的文件大小。同时,注意避免在动画中过度使用transform以外的属性(如fillopacity),因为它们可能触发重排或重绘,造成卡顿。可通过Chrome DevTools中的Performance面板实时监测动画帧率,确保每秒稳定运行60帧。对于老旧浏览器环境,应遵循渐进增强原则,提供降级方案,保证基础功能可用。

  解决常见问题,提升兼容性与稳定性

  浏览器兼容性是许多开发者头疼的问题之一。虽然主流浏览器对SVG的支持已非常成熟,但在部分旧版IE或移动设备上仍可能出现渲染异常。此时,可以通过添加适当的polyfill或使用条件注释引入备用方案。例如,当检测到不支持SVG时,自动回退为静态图片。另外,动画卡顿往往源于事件监听过多或脚本阻塞。建议将动画逻辑异步执行,并合理控制动画频率,避免高频触发。对于长时间运行的动效,考虑加入暂停/恢复机制,提升用户体验。

  长期价值:推动前端向创意与互动演进

  高质量的SVG动图不仅是视觉上的加分项,更是品牌专业形象的重要体现。它能让用户在不经意间感受到细节打磨带来的愉悦感,从而延长页面停留时间,提高转化率。从长远来看,掌握SVG动图的创作能力,意味着前端开发不再局限于静态页面搭建,而是迈向更具创意与互动性的方向。无论是企业官网、营销落地页,还是小程序内的引导动画,都能通过巧妙运用SVG动图实现差异化表达。

  我们专注于为企业提供定制化的网页视觉解决方案,涵盖SVG动图设计、H5页面开发及交互逻辑实现,擅长将复杂动效转化为高效可维护的代码结构,帮助客户在不牺牲性能的前提下实现惊艳的视觉呈现,微信同号18140119082

SVG动图在响应式设计中的应用,企业官网SVG动图设计,SVG动图,电商网站SVG动图交互开发